Transaction 394f41609a9d05843d6af2a5071ccf38c986a3620e30a2d8f3aa783a6736876d
1 Input
1 Output
-
394f41609a9d05843d6af2a5071ccf38c986a3620e30a2d8f3aa783a6736876d:0
- value
- 316075391
- script pubkey
- OP_0 OP_PUSHBYTES_20 56fea979391dbdebe4fbdbc2efa4deee30b2d602
- address
- bc1q2ml2j7ferk77he8mm0pwlfx7acct94sz2jne2m